One of the first problems I ran into when first burning was I was burning games too fast, I would get bad game copies or copies that would boot up occassionally, I had to go to burning at 1x or 2x then everything as fine. I'm mentioning this just as a reminder as I think the demo version of CDrwin only burns at 1x.
I would say make sure you watch the settings on the read and then burn, read sub-channel data and make sure it burns without correcting the files.
